UNESCO WHS Serie - World Heritage Sites in Finland - Old Rauma - Situated on the Gulf of Botnia, Rauma is one of the oldest harbours in Finland. Built around a Franciscan monastery, where the mid-15th-century Holy Cross Church still stands, it is an outstanding example of an old Nordic city constructed in wood. Although ravaged by fire in the late 17th century, it has preserved its ancient vernacular architectural heritage. Name: Old Rauma Country: Finland Location: Region of Satakunta, Province of Western Finland Inscription: 1991 Category: Cultural (iv)(v) Unesco Ref: 582 Special Feature: The card has a QR-Code on the backside to navigate for more Informationas about the site.
